摘要

拟建的渤海海峡隧道采用隧道掘进机(TBM)施工极具挑战性,其中关键之一就是TBM的掘进速率预测问题。本文将渤海海峡隧道和澳大利亚Clem Jones 隧道进行工程类比,并介绍了比能法在Clem Jones 隧道的应用情况。在Clem Jones 隧道施工过程中,相关研究人员运用比能法对TBM的可掘性进行了分析及预测,从后期的掘进情况来看比能法的预测结果与实际施工吻合得较好。本文在Clem Jones 隧道和渤海海峡隧道对比分析的基础上,认为运用比能法预测TBM的可掘性同样适用于渤海海峡隧道的TBM施工。

Abstract

The proposed Bohai Strait tunnel is a challenging project, and penetration rate of tunnel boring machine (TBM) is one of the keys. This paper made a contrast between the Clem Jones tunnel in Australia and the Bohai Strait tunnel,and introduced the specific energy used in the Clem Jones tunnel. During the construction of the Clem Jones tunnel, researchers made the analysis and forecasted about the TBM's penetration rate using the specific energy, which was identical to the practical construction very well. This paper concluded that the specific energy can be used in the Bohai Strait tunnel as well as the Clem Jones tunnel,which was based on the comparative analysis of the Clem Jones tunnel and Bohai Strait tunnel.
